Summary The School Board of Alachua County (SBAC) has expressed its intent to continue the School Resource Officer Program (SROP) with the City of Alachua for the four schools within our jurisdiction - Santa Fe High School, Mebane Middle School, Alachua Elementary School and Irby Elementary School. As such, the SBAC requested that the City enter into another service agreement for the 2018-2019 school year.
The City Commission approved the agreement on April 23, 2018 and the SBAC subsequently approved it as well. Since the approval of the agreement, the SBAC has been in negotiations with the Alachua County Sheriff's Office for school resource deputy services in schools where cities do not have police services. The Sheriff's Office requested an increase in funding beyond what was proposed by the SBAC. Therefore, the SBAC agreed to a one-time increase of funding for the 2018-2019 school year. The City was contacted by the SBAC stating that the SBAC is extending the same increase to all SROP agencies and requested an amendment to the 2018-2019 agreement.
The agreement approved on April 23, 2018 provided $151,020.00 in funding. The proposed amendment provides $178,918.00 in funding.
Funds will again be paid to the City in ten monthly payments, beginning 10/30/2018; monthly payments shall be one-tenth of the agreed total share, provided the SROP positions are staffed by 10/01/2018. |
